Playoff time in the fantasy world. This is the best season for it as there is a great deal of parity on both sides of the league. We’re not likely to see teams resting starters to prep for the playoffs. At this point the 5-7 New York Giants have a legitimate playoff chance and even a shot a winning the division (should they win out). Yep, its that kind of season, which means its going to be that kind of playoff battle in the fantasy world.
My team was solid through the first 6 weeks and then went 3-4 over the last seven. Our decline began when Vick stopped playing, but it didn’t end there. Now my crew is dangerously close to being knocked out of the first round–a possibility that rests entirely on the shoulders of the once-great Ray Rice. It is there I’ll begin my weekly pics.
MIN over BAL
Numbers don’t lie, and Rice’s numbers have been abysmal. The Ravens have become a one-dimensional team. Be it Rice or any one of the nameless backups, they simply cannot run. Minnesota runs just fine, which is where I believe the difference will be felt.
